Ergonomic lifting techniques for athletic body types

Mastery over the physical handling of a high-density, muscular-sculpted companion requires a shift from brute force to mechanical leverage. Structural stress points differ in muscular models; the increased weight distribution and complex limb articulation mean that joint longevity is highly dependent on proper storage positioning to prevent material fatigue or ‘sagging’ in sculpted muscle groups. Implement these protocols to minimize personal physical strain while preserving the integrity of the elastomer.

  1. Center of Mass Calibration: Before initiating any movement, locate the doll’s center of gravity. Muscular models often feature dense, heavy-set shoulders and reinforced core structures compared to standard builds. Always grip the torso near the lumbar region to distribute the weight across your own core, rather than relying on your peripheral arm strength.
  2. The Pivot-Point Maneuver: When positioning large dolls, utilize the skeletal frame as a fulcrum. Never attempt to lift the companion vertically from a supine position; instead, rotate the torso onto its side, then use the hip as a pivot point to transition to a seated or standing posture. This technique relies on rotational momentum, significantly reducing the vertical load on your lower back.
  3. Limb Articulation Management: Muscular models possess high-tension internal armatures. When moving the arms, support the weight of the limb at the elbow and wrist simultaneously to prevent torque on the shoulder joints. Overextending a heavy limb without support can cause micro-tears in the synthetic dermal layer or premature failure of the internal joint locks.
  4. Utilize Gravity-Assisted Transitions: Safe doll positioning techniques require an understanding of how elastomer skin interacts with friction. If the doll is wearing textured sportswear, use the fabric to your advantage by creating a grip-point. Use a sliding motion on a low-friction surface, such as a specialized mat, to move the weight rather than lifting it entirely off the ground.
  5. Joint Neutralization: Following any adjustment, ensure the limbs are in a neutral position. Leaving a heavy limb suspended in a high-tension pose causes the internal armature to bear the load of the elastomer weight for extended durations. This leads to permanent deformation of the sculpted aesthetic.

Stabilizing heavy frames on domestic surfaces

Muscular sex dolls are categorized as a specific body type segment within the broader adult doll market, often requiring distinct structural engineering to emulate athletic builds. Given the increased density of high-definition abdominal and quadricep sculpts, the center of gravity shifts significantly compared to standard-build counterparts. You must mitigate this variance to prevent structural fatigue in the skeletal armature or unintended surface slippage.

  1. Deploy high-friction contact points. When positioning a heavy-set doll on domestic furniture, the primary risk is lateral sliding caused by the weight of the muscular limbs. Utilize silicone-based grip mats or industrial-grade anti-slip pads between the doll’s pelvic base and the seating surface. This increases the coefficient of friction, ensuring the frame remains locked in place during physical engagement without requiring excessive manual bracing.
  2. Implement weight management for dolls via auxiliary bolsters. A heavy doll’s frame often exerts uneven pressure on lumbar and hip joints if left unsupported. Use high-density memory foam wedges placed strategically under the glutes or behind the back. This redistributes the mass across a wider surface area, reducing the strain on the doll’s internal joints and preventing the “sinking” effect that occurs when heavy-set frames rest on soft residential cushions.
  3. Calibrate heavy doll furniture support. Standard residential furniture is rarely rated for the concentrated weight of a high-end, muscular-build doll. If you are utilizing a sofa or display bench, verify the load-bearing capacity of the frame. Opt for furniture with reinforced steel legs or solid wood bases to prevent bowing. If your furniture lacks this, secondary support struts can be installed beneath the frame to transfer the weight directly to the floor, bypassing the furniture’s internal suspension system.
  4. Leverage rotational anchoring. When moving the doll into a seated or supine position, avoid dragging the base across the surface. Instead, create a pivot point using a low-friction slider disc temporarily placed under the heaviest contact point—usually the pelvic region. Once the doll is rotated into the desired orientation, remove the disc to allow the base to seat firmly on the grip mats. This minimizes the physical force required from you, effectively bypassing the logistical burden of shifting a massive, high-density frame.
